IREON New Member Profile: Alex Lipsky

Name: Alex Lipsky

Title: Owner

Company: Lipsky Construction

Location: 814 Montauk Highway, Bayport, NY 11705

Birthplace: Islip, NY

Education: SUNY Oneonta, Adelphi University

First job: Divemaster – Boy Scouts of America

First job in real estate or allied field: Project manager – Lipsky Construction

What Year did you join IREON: 2023

What do you do now and what are you planning for the future? We are known regionally as a premier developer-focused commercial construction company, delivering exceptional results to our clients throughout the entire construction process. Our proactive approach to construction starts during the preconstruction phase and the benefits are realized with an expedited close out for a true turnkey operation. As we continue to grow, we are planning on expanding our incredible team of experts, while bringing in the latest technologies to add continued value to our growing list of great clients.

One fun fact about you is: I am a certified scuba diving instructor and training to become a professional ski instructor, so no matter the season you can find me outside!

Two words to describe your work environment: Proactive and collaborative.

Three things on your bucket list: Obtain my professional ski instructor certification, travel the world with my amazing family, and teaching my daughters how to scuba dive.

Favorite streaming series: “Succession”

Favorite movie: “Jurassic Park”

Favorite book: “Traction”

Favorite vacation destination: The Galapagos was incredible!!

If you could invite one person to dinner (living or dead, but NOT related to you) who would it be and where would you go? Robin Williams for a burger and fries.

Rules to live by in business: Maintain Integrity and collaborate through active communication

What is your DREAM job? (NOT your current job)?  I used to teach scuba diving in the Florida Keys…it wasn’t terrible!

SABRE coordinates sale of six properties totaling 199,845 s/f

Huntington, NY SABRE Real Estate Advisors has completed the sale of six commercial properties across Long Island and Northern New Jersey, further underscoring the firm’s strength as a trusted partner in complex real estate transactions. The deals were led by executive vice presidents Jimmy Aug and Stu Fagen, whose combined expertise continues to drive exceptional results for clients across the region.
